History Of Karaoke

Karaoke came on scene first in Asia, Japan to be precise, as far back as 1971. And although it’s now popular all over America, the United States didn’t actually embrace the entertainment form until much later.

It was Daisuke Inoue that designed and invented the first karaoke machine in 1971, in Kobe, Japan. However, according to Inoue, the name “Karaoke” didn’t come from him. The story of the name is actually a pretty interesting one. So, keep reading.

Apparently, there was a certain situation in Japan when an orchestra went on strike. And then instead of the orchestra, the guys there had to play music with a machine instead. On seeing that, a certain Japanese entertainment group coined the name “karaoke”.

karaoke machine reviews

Guess what? The name karaoke in English means “empty orchestra”. Pretty interesting story, right?

So, what exactly led to this ingenious invention? Now, Inoue himself was a musician too. So, whenever he had guests over, they would always ask him for recordings of his songs so they could sing along. Side note: it was customary to entertain your guests to some music in Japan in those days.

Realizing this gap, therefore, Inoue decided to create the karaoke machine. Prior to this, he had already recorded some of his keyboard music for a certain company president with success. This provided a good knowledge base for Inoue to create what we now know as the karaoke machine.

What Is Karaoke?

So, in karaoke, people basically choose a song they like and then sing along to the instrumental version of the song. As part of the setup, there’s usually a screen which displays the lyrics to the song to help the singer sing along correctly.

Voice Effects

Many people shy away from karaoke because they feel like they can’t sing and they don’t want to embarrass themselves. Voice effects are great as they can help to put everyone more at ease.

Although the most common voice effect is the echo, there are other silly effects like alien or robot voices. Of course, if you’re getting this kind of machine, ensure you can also turn off the effect. You don’t want to shroud the next Beyonce’s voice in a silly alien voice effect.

Furthermore, in a professional setup, many often feature more advanced settings such as equalizers, echo effect, pitch control, and more.

There’s also the AVC feature. It’s another advanced feature which, in full, is the Auto voice Control. Auto Voice Control senses when you have stopped singing, probably to catch a breath, and then fills the blanks with recorded vocals. It stops this once you resume singing. Pretty cool, right?

How Does A Karaoke Machine Work?

In the beginning, karaoke machines could only work one way. That is, the user would slot in a CD+G disc containing the song they wanted to sing along to. And then they sing along with the karaoke machine or a TV screen displaying the lyrics.

For those who don’t know CD+G discs are pretty much the same as CDs. However, the “+G” factor there represents the ability to also playback graphics which, in this case, would be the lyrics of the song.

The Limitation Of These CD+G Discs Is That You Can Only Sing One Song Except you want to amass a giant library of CDs. Two words for that: cumbersome and expensive.

But thanks to technology, all that has changed and there are many more options than the CD+G era. You can use a USB flash stick and YouTube.

The YouTube part is a bit tricky though as many karaoke machines can’t really access YouTube wirelessly on their own. You need to have an HDTV with the YouTube app. So, your TV streams the song and lyrics while your machine streams the microphone sound.

Or, you can scroll through the lyrics on your phone while streaming the audio with your karaoke machine via an audio cable. There are several options.

Types Of Karaoke Machines

There are four types of karaoke machines which are:

  • All-in-one.
  • TV Monitor System.
  • PA Systems.
  • MP3 System.

Let’s explain each of them one after the other. Of course, we will also explain how each of them work.

All-in-One

As you can probably already tell from the name, “All-in-One” karaoke systems come with everything you need for your karaoke gig. There’s a CD player integrated to play your karaoke CDs. Of course they don’t also feature karaoke CDs. You’d have to get those yourself.

Anyway, these machines also feature a built-in monitor so singer and audience can sing along to the lyrics. But the small problem is that most of these pack a small screen usually about 14 or 15 inches max in height.

Nonetheless, all-in-one systems are an excellent option for those looking for a portable unit especially if you don’t want to buy extra equipment.

TV Monitor System

This is a great karaoke system to use when you’re hosting a crowd of people. So, instead of displaying lyrics on a tiny screen, you just use an RCA cable to hook up your machine to your TV. This way, the TV displays the lyrics.

Some of these systems already come with a cartridge containing a massive library of songs. And if you want to expand your song library, then you can buy additional cartridges too. For others, you’d have to purchase your songs differently.

Besides the TV, you can also hook your system up to an existing speaker system as well. For those who own their own speaker system, the TV Monitor Karaoke System is a great option for them for this reason.

Moreover, being able to hook up your own speakers is quite convenient. This is because even if the accompanying speakers are not as powerful as you’d like, then you can always use your own existing speaker systems.

Many of these systems also come with built-in microphones and a stereo-system connection so you can hear the performer through the speakers. Some even also feature voice effects as well.

The TV Monitor System is even more portable than the all-in-one system.

PA Systems

Well, these days, more and more people are beginning to use their PA systems as karaoke machines. Although these systems are pretty similar to karaoke machines, they differ in that they don’t display graphics.

What they do better though is produce much better sound quality with a much higher level of versatility. PA systems are great for dance parties, band practice, announcements, or even tailgating.

The downside though is that you’d have to go read your lyrics elsewhere. This could be a little tricky as half the fun of karaoke is audience participation.

Best Karaoke Machine

All the same, there’s one way you can go about this. That is, you stream the video straight to your TV using Bluetooth connection. However, you’d need some pretty good tech skills on your side to do that.

So, in summary, PA systems are great for sound quality and versatility. However, get ready to do some work and probably get an intermediary device if you want it to work perfectly.

MP3 System

For access to all the latest songs, an MP3 system is your best bet. So, this boycotts the need to use karaoke CDs and whatnot since you can easily download them straight from the internet even before the singer releases the album.

When doing this, you want to ensure that you’re getting the karaoke version of your favorite track though. That is, a version where the vocals have been removed and just the instrumentals are left.

MP3 systems are pretty convenient systems as you can use your smartphone or a USB to play your favorite songs. Plus, the number of songs you can play are really up to you.

Furthermore, many MP3 systems come with a remote controller as well as microphones. Others might also feature built-in screens, while others might need a TV to display lyrics.

More so, these days, MP3 systems are becoming increasingly popular for connectivity and flexibility purposes. Fortunately, they are available in a wide range of prices. So, everybody can get their hands on one that works for them.
